Vue是一個(gè)流行的JavaScript框架,提供了很多有用的工具來簡(jiǎn)化開發(fā)過程。其中一個(gè)常用的工具是cookie,它可以幫助開發(fā)者管理和存儲(chǔ)用戶的信息。在這篇文章中,我們將討論Vue中如何使用cookie。
首先,我們需要安裝Vue Cookie插件。它可以通過npm進(jìn)行安裝:
npm install vue-cookie
在Vue中使用cookie非常簡(jiǎn)單。首先,導(dǎo)入Vue Cookie:
import VueCookie from 'vue-cookie'; Vue.use(VueCookie);
現(xiàn)在我們已經(jīng)成功導(dǎo)入了Vue Cookie。可以設(shè)置cookie的名稱,值,過期時(shí)間等等。例如:
this.$cookie.set('name', 'Jon Snow', 1);
在這個(gè)例子中,我們將名稱設(shè)置為“name”,值為“Jon Snow”,過期時(shí)間為1天。我們也可以使用get方法來獲取cookie值:
let name = this.$cookie.get('name'); console.log(name);
如果需要?jiǎng)h除cookie,我們可以使用Vue Cookie的remove方法:
this.$cookie.remove('name');
Vue Cookie還具有許多其他功能,如自動(dòng)JSON序列化,使用數(shù)組或?qū)ο蟮取?梢酝ㄟ^閱讀文檔進(jìn)一步了解。
總的來說,Vue Cookie是一個(gè)非常有用的插件,可以幫助開發(fā)者管理用戶的信息和數(shù)據(jù)。它容易使用,只需簡(jiǎn)單的幾行代碼就可以實(shí)現(xiàn)。所以,在Vue開發(fā)中,使用Vue Cookie是一個(gè)值得考慮的選擇。